The total number of members nominated by the President
to the Lok Sabha and the Rajya Sabha is:Solution
As per Articles 80(1)(a) and 331, the President can nominate 2 members to Lok Sabha from Anglo-Indian community (now abolished), and according to Article 80, 12 members to Rajya Sabha, making a total of 14. However, earlier there were provisions for 2 Lok Sabha + 12 Rajya Sabha = 14. Note: The nomination of Anglo-Indian members to Lok Sabha was abolished by the 104th Amendment (2020). So now, the corrected number stands at 12.
